This patch adds asynchronous evaluation for session blocks in
Python. It also adds functionality to implement async session eval for
other languages using ob-comint.el.

To test the attached patch, add ":async" to a Python session block
with a long computation (or "time.sleep") in it. Upon evaluation, your
Emacs won't freeze to wait for the result -- instead, a placeholder
will be inserted, and replaced with the true result when it's ready.

I'll note how this is different from some related projects. ob-async
implements asynchronous evaluation for Babel, but it doesn't work with
sessions. emacs-jupyter, ein, and ob-ipython all implement
asynchronous session evaluation, but only for Jupyter kernels. Jupyter
is great for some cases, but sometimes I prefer to use the built-in
org-babel languages without jupyter.

The new functionality is mainly implemented in
`org-babel-comint-async-filter', which I've defined in ob-comint.el,
and added as a hook to `comint-output-filter-functions'.  Whenever new
output is added to the comint buffer, the filter scans for an
indicator token (this is inspired by
`org-babel-comint-with-output'). Upon encountering the token, the
filter uses a regular expression to extract a UUID or temp-file
associated with the result, then searches for the appropriate location
to add the result to.

This is my 2nd attempt at this patch [0]. I have also ported it to an
external package [1], but would like to have this functionality in Org
proper, to permit better code reuse between async and sync
implementations. The external package also includes an R
implementation that I regularly use, as well as a Ruby implementation,
but I've left these out to keep this initial patch smaller, and also I
need to confirm copyright assignment on the Ruby implementation which
was externally contributed.

+*** Async session evaluation
+
+The =:async= header argument can be used for asynchronous evaluation
+in session blocks for certain languages.
+
+Currently, async evaluation is supported in Python.  There is also
+functionality to implement async evaluation in other languages that
+use comint, but this needs to be done on a per-language basis.
+
+By default, async evaluation is disabled unless the =:async= header
+argument is present.  You can also set =:async no= to force it off
+(for example if you've set =:async= in a property drawer).
+
+Async evaluation is disabled during export.

ob-python session blocks don't use "return", so this should just be:

#+begin_src python :async :session blah
a
#+end_src

#+RESULTS:
: 2

> Finally, I see that this requires :session to be set in order to work.
> Might it be possible to have this work for non-session blocks too? It
> seems odd that what I'd imagine is the harder case (session blocks) is
> supported, but one-shot (non-session) blocks aren't.

The non-session case is substantially different, and I think it would
probably require a separate implementation.

One possible approach would be to modify ob-eval.el, so that
org-babel--shell-command-on-region uses make-process instead of
process-file.

I agree it would be nice to have, but it would take a bit of work to
figure it all out, and there is already ob-async.el [1] that implements
non-session async for all languages. (I wish it could be brought into
org-mode, but it probably can't, because it depends on the external
async.el.)
